Blockchain-Based Educational Record System with Improved Byzantine Algorithm and Proof of Stake

Abstract

To address the limitations of traditional educational record management systems in terms of data security, trustworthiness, and consensus efficiency, this study designs a blockchain-based educational record management system and proposes an enhanced consensus algorithm, REL-PosBFT, which integrates a dynamic reputation model and a hierarchical architecture. The system adopts a multi-role collaboration mechanism, incorporating Verifiable Random Functions, Threshold Signatures, and dynamic reputation evaluation to achieve trustworthy data recording and adaptive access control. A simulation environment is built using NS-3 and Docker to evaluate the system’s performance in latency, throughput, and security. Experimental results show that REL-PosBFT delivers superior response speed and scalability in high-concurrency, multi-node scenarios, demonstrating greater stability and practicality compared to the original PoS-BFT and mainstream consensus algorithms.
